The reading right now

As of January 2024, Foreign direct investment inflows for Spain stood at 2.48%. That is down 0.42 percentage points from the prior year. Over the trailing five years, the series has averaged 3.26%, ranging from a low of 2.16% in January 2019 to a high of 4.66% in January 2022. The current reading sits 0.65 percentage points below its trailing ten-year mean of 3.13%.
